It means, if i start writing a client email, i get the autocomplete, but if I put a second one, separated by comma or ; , it does not recognize the second email.
[...]

OTRS wants every adress in a new line. Therefore it automatically adds a new to field, if you entered an adress in the first one. Every new field also supports the auto completion. At least with OTRS 3.1.

But the use of a seperator for multiple addresses is AFAIK not implemented, I'm sorry.
